ROHR, John Brian

Service Number: 411263
Enlisted: 27 April 1941
Last Rank: Sergeant
Last Unit: No. 13 Squadron (RAAF)
Born: Mudgee, New South Wales, Australia, 3 November 1916
Home Town: Marrickville, Marrickville, New South Wales
Schooling: Not yet discovered
Occupation: Not yet discovered
Died: Flying Battle, Darwin, Northern Territory, Australia , 27 April 1942, aged 25 years
Cemetery: Adelaide River War Cemetery, NT
G.B.7. , Adelaide River War Cemetery, Adelaide River, Northern Territory, Australia
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our

Biography contributed by David Barlow

Son of Stanley Harley Rohr & Ellenor Mary Rohr

Husband of Valerie Eunice Rohr of Undercliffe, NSW

 

 

Four RAAF personnel were killed in an enemy air-raid on the Darwin aerodrome -

Sergeant Douglas Charles Ellis Upjohn 411267 of 13 Squadron

Sergeant John Brian Rohr 411263 of 13 Squadron

Sergeant Vincent Arthur Doran 2882 of Station Headquarters Darwin

Corporal Francis Kenneth Lewis 17280 of Station Headquarters Darwin

(details from book “The 13 Squadron Story” - Lewis is not mentioned by name, book quotes four personnel KIA in raid and names Upjohn, Rohr & Doran)
